anal fistula - abnormal connection between anal canal and skin
Definition for anal fistula
An anal fistula is an abnormal connection between the epithelialised surface of the anal canal and (usually) the perianal skin.
more
An anal fistula is an abnormal connection between the epithelialised surface of the anal canal and (usually) the perianal skin. (See definition of a fistula).
Anal fistulae originate from the anal glands, which are located between the two layers of the anal sphincters and which drain into the anal canal. If the outlet of these glands becomes blocked, an abscess can form which can eventually point to the skin surface. The tract formed by this process is the fistula.
